Get started17 Homewelland House is a one-bedroom mid-terrace house in Market Harborough (LE16 7BT). It has a recorded floor area of 38 m² (around 413 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(February 2011) returns a B (score 82), comfortably above the UK average. Main heating runs on electricity. The latest certificate is from February 2011,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. At 38 m² this is the 13th smallest of 38 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 37–59 m². The building's EPC ratings span D to B, with this unit at the top.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 2.4%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£103,000 sits 167.5% above the 2012 sale of £38,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£93/sq ft) was about 27.8% below the postcode norm.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 81% of similar EPCs). 1 bedrooms is on the smaller side for this postcode, where 3 is the typical count.
